The coupling nut is a longer kind of nut that offers a slightly various purpose from a common hex nut. Instead of merely fastening 2 surfaces together, a coupling nut is made to sign up with two threaded poles or bolts end to finish. When additional size is required or when a constant threaded link has to be produced, this makes it specifically helpful. Coupling nuts are usual in building and construction, pipes, repair work, and steel fabrication. They are usually used with threaded rod to prolong reach, support sustains, or change spacing in settings up. Because they are longer than conventional nuts, coupling nuts supply even more thread interaction, which can increase toughness and security. In jobs where precision issues, they can also help straighten parts extra accurately. Their uncomplicated style makes them a useful remedy for extending threaded systems without requiring welding or custom machining.
Threaded rod is an additional essential attaching component that appears in a broad array of applications. Unlike a bolt, which has a head at one end, threaded rod is typically a long, straight rod with threads running along its entire size or a huge portion of it. This continual threading gives it outstanding flexibility in construction and installment. Threaded rod can be cut to details sizes and utilized with hex nuts, coupling nuts, washing machines, or brackets to produce tailored fastening plans. It is often found in suspended ceiling systems, electric assistances, pipeline wall mounts, support settings up, and mechanical installments. Threaded rod is extremely useful in jobs that need flexible or uncommon measurements due to the fact that it can be cut and adjusted on-site. Its ability to carry stress and attach structural components makes it among one of the most versatile components in the fastening globe. In several scenarios, threaded rod acts as the foundation of a system where other parts attach and secure around it.
A stud is a bolt that appears like a bolt without a head, normally threaded on both ends or along its full length. One end of the stud may be installed into a tapped opening or embedded in a part, while the various other end approves a nut. Studs are especially useful in atmospheres where parts are removed and replaced routinely, because the stud stays in location and the nut can be serviced much more quickly.
These fasteners may appear similar, the differences among them matter a fantastic offer in real-world use. Selecting in between a hex bolt, hex nut, coupling nut, threaded rod, and stud depends upon the sort of lots, the products being signed up with, the requirement for adjustability, and the environment in which the setting up will run. If two plates need to be clamped snugly with each other, a hex bolt and hex nut are typically the finest choice. A coupling nut coupled with threaded rod might be a lot more effective if a connection should be prolonged. A stud could provide the right option if a maker component needs a set threaded anchor point. These differences are crucial because utilizing the wrong bolt can minimize toughness, boost the threat of helping to loosen, or make maintenance much more challenging.
